A with most things, this has come up before and discussed at length. About authenticators and MS authenticator, see at least these three threads:
For me Waydroid is no option. Its a waste of money, energy, privacy and time. Just have some old lineageos for some not daily used apps by hand and in usage. For the Rest and Most of my privacy i have ma Librem5. The Android is offline, without battery if i not need to use it (like for social exchange - mostly over fediverse). Surveillance Code are stay in Alphabet/Apple/Meta/Microsoft Apps and will leak if you use it, so minimize the time for that and your own dependency on it. Apps are like your Car or public cameras… they snitching on you.
Any idea on how to get the landscape fullscreen working? The app does work amazingly otherwise, but every time I try to get the full landscape view, waydroid doesnt resize properly inside PureOS.
You have to start the container with the L5 in landscape mode for Waydroid landscape mode to work😐
Well thats not a solution… Lol. But I appreciate the tip.
I mean it’s a solution to the question you asked. It’s not a solution for getting waydroid to dynamically resize when rotated, but that wasn’t the question asked. Even if it could be inferred as the long term desire from the added context.
Yes, I was able to do that. Initially I didn’t. Pretty sure all I did was:
sudo waydroid init -s GAPPS -f
then followed Google Play Certification - Waydroid so I didn’t get relentless notifications.
(Sorry that’s just GAPPS working. I don’t know about the MS Authenticator)
I tried that too. Although installation is not a issue, the MS Authenticator configuration does not go through. Thanks for the suggestion though
I just used a workout app, 7 Minute Workout, with Waydroid on my Librem 5. Super useful!
Hi!
It have been quite some time since you (@dos ) did your great job in porting Waydroid to Librem 5. As I can see, the upstream since then have moved forward. Were your fixes included upstream? Or should I try to rebase your changes onto the latest version from upstream and try to build it myself?
Just saying:
Back when I was having issues connecting my Waydroid to the internet (it could never get a connection, despite having access everywhere else outside of Waydroid). I had tried everything, firewall permissions, uninstalling and re-installing again, etc just doing different things.
I don’t know why, but after a distro update, all a sudden Waydroid now had internet access.
That was maybe more than a year ago mind you. I don’t use it that often, but I have now always enjoyed the experience of using it when needed.
Waydroid on postmarketos runs fairly well with the following observations:
- after wake from suspend bridge connection isnt enabled or active, running wayland session stop, start sometimes works
- newpipe does not play any videos
- sometimes when starting session full screen ui and the phosh keyboard is unfolded the wayland session shrinks to size above keyboard and does not restore fully
- copy paste initially works but stops working after a while maybe also related to wake from suspend
- i had to create to swap files total 4GB so i wasnt running out of memory
- when you swipe up to close the container it doesnt appear to properly stop or suspend session, and you have to do that from the terminal otherwise it wont start selecting waydroid app icon or any android app icon
- its a little buggy and freezes at times or ignores touch input and switching away to linux apps causes them to run pretty slow
- phone gets pretty hot and doesnt run optimized or maybe doesnt offload enough to GPU
- camera does not work
Has anyone had any success getting Waydroid to run on Mobian Trixie? I added the Waydroid Trixie repository, but I am not sure how to resolve the policykit-1 dependency. It appears that it was replaced by polkitd & pkexec, and creating a symbolic link from these to where policykit-1 is expected did not seem to do the trick, or maybe I did it wrong.
I previously had success running it of course on Byzantanium, but the installation process has changed since then (much simpler I may add, just one command to install).
Yes, waydroid is running on Mobian trixie. With same limitations as on Byzanthium (no access to camera). I don’t remember having troubles to install it.
I just set up MS Authenticator in my Waydroid and it works fine, I’m able to authenticate with push notifications. I used GAPPS and the Google Play Store.
I would like to try again with MicroG (which I understand also supports push notifications?) and Aurora Store instead of my personal Google account that I’m trying to get rid of, but at least the urgent requirement of being able to log in to my work system is satisfied. I could not scan the QR code but was able to type a code and URL and it was satisfied.
I still have two Android applications I can’t live without (banking, and another work-related second factor), and they need the camera to scan 2D codes (I think not QR, but similar). I tried some time ago to set up a fake camera serving a static image, the plan being to take a picture of the code with the Librem5 camera app, then pass it to that fake camera pipe, so the apps think they’re having a live view.
Maybe I’ll try again. Anyone did something similar yet?
Workaround here:
Is there a workaround for a pin being required or does your deployment not require a PIN?
That hasn’t been an issue for me. I guess, as you say, that my employer set it like that, not to require a PIN…